Grosvenor Motel - Hamilton
-37.778116, 175.271402Overview
Grosvenor Motel Hamilton offers quick access to Whitiora Bible Church, situated around 5 minutes' walk away. Located 2.5 km from the Waterworld water park, the motel features 41 rooms with views of the courtyard.
Location
Hamilton Zoo is approximately 10 minutes away by car, while the Waikato Stadium is within reach of this 4-star hotel. The Grosvenor Motel is also 4.1 km from such natural sights as the Māori Te Parapara Hamilton Gardens. Shopping enthusiasts will enjoy being in proximity to Prodrive Golf.
This accommodation is located 20 km from John C. Munro Hamilton International airport and only a 5-minute walk from 165 Ulster St bus stop.
Rooms
The hotel offers rooms with a seating area complete with climate control. These rooms at the property also feature carpet floors. Guests will make use of hair dryers and complimentary toiletries in bathrooms equipped with an additional toilet and a shower.
Eat & Drink
The Helm is adjacent to Grosvenor Motel, 450 metres away.
Leisure & Business
This hotel features an indoor swimming pool on site.
